
LNG Exports Are Not Driving Up Prices; Policy Failures Are
February 27, 2026
The narrative that liquified natural gas (LNG) exports are directly linked to natural gas prices here in the U.S. continues to circulate, but such assertions ignore contrary evidence. There is no correlation, and blaming LNG for high electricity bills is a scapegoat used by lawmakers to hide poor policy decisions that are actually contributing factors.
